Structured additive regression modeling of age of menarche and menopause in a breast cancer screening program

Breast cancer risk is believed to be associated with several reproductive factors, such as early menarche and late menopause. This study is based on the registries of the first time a woman enters the screening program, and presents a spatio-temporal analysis of the variables age of menarche and age of menopause along with other reproductive and socioeconomic factors. The database was provided by the Portuguese Cancer League (LPCC), a private nonprofit organization dealing with multiple issues related to oncology of which the Breast Cancer Screening Program is one of its main activities. The registry consists of 259,652 records of women who entered the screening program for the first time between 1990 and 2007 (45-69-year age group). Structured Additive Regression (STAR) models were used to explore spatial and temporal correlations with a wide range of covariates. These models are flexible enough to deal with a variety of complex datasets, allowing us to reveal possible relationships among the variables considered in this study. The analysis shows that early menarche occurs in younger women and in municipalities located in the interior of central Portugal. Women living in inland municipalities register later ages for menopause, and those born in central Portugal after 1933 show a decreasing trend in the age of menopause. Younger ages of menarche and late menopause are observed in municipalities with a higher purchasing power index. The analysis performed in this study portrays the time evolution of the age of menarche and age of menopause and their spatial characterization, adding to the identification of factors that could be of the utmost importance in future breast cancer incidence research.
机译:据信乳腺癌的危险与多种生殖因素有关,例如初潮初潮和绝经后期。这项研究基于女性首次进入筛查计划的登记册,并提出了对初潮年龄和更年期年龄以及其他生殖和社会经济因素的时空分析。该数据库由葡萄牙癌症联盟(LPCC)提供,这是一个私人非营利组织,致力于处理与肿瘤学相关的多个问题,乳腺癌筛查计划是其主要活动之一。该登记处包含259,652条在1990年至2007年(45-69岁年龄段)之间首次进入筛查计划的女性记录。结构化加性回归(STAR)模型用于探索具有广泛协变量的时空相关性。这些模型足够灵活,可以处理各种复杂的数据集,从而使我们能够揭示本研究中考虑的变量之间的可能关系。分析表明,初潮初潮发生在年轻妇女和葡萄牙中部内部的城市。居住在内陆自治市的妇女更年期更晚,而1933年以后出生在葡萄牙中部的妇女则显示出更年期的减少趋势。在购买力指数较高的城市中,初潮和更年期的年龄较小。在这项研究中进行的分析描绘了初潮年龄和绝经年龄的时间演变及其空间特征,并增加了对可能在未来乳腺癌发病率研究中最重要的因素的识别。
